Title :
An integral based event triggered control scheme of distributed network systems

Abstract :
In this paper we consider an event-triggered solution to the consensus problem of multi-agent systems. Our main contribution consists of the use of an integral based approach that is shown to reduce the conservatism intrinsic in the use of Lyapunov methods.
